This Magazine

Progressive politics, ideas & culture

Menu

Keystone XL

Friday FTW: Keystone Pipeline protested, everybody wins!

Joe Thomson

It’s a rare thing when a video surfaces surrounding a Keystone XL pipeline when all sides come out looking good. Such is the case in the video above at an event in Boston regarding Obama’s Health Care plan. The protesters bring some much needed publicity to their cause and with his usual glib charm, Obama […] More »